The center console box has a two-layer structure consisting of an upper compartment and a lower compartment.

Upper compartment

1) Upper compartment lock release Pull up the upper compartment lock release to open the upper compartment.

Lower compartment

1) Lower compartment lock release

Pull up the lower compartment lock release to open the lower compartment.
